Hey guys I have a 1998 ranger XLT x-cab v6 4 liter 4x4, and I am about to order my 3 inch performance accessories body lift. I need to order tires at the same time just to save time and money on shipping. I plan on getting a 15x10 rim with about a -44 ish offset. Would 33x12.5 fit comfortably without the torsion crank or is that a must? I know this might have been covered before but i just wanted a more personal answer to my specific truck instead of piecing other info together.

Thanks in advance
 
Id say yes. ive seen 2wds with the 3" Bl and they fit 33"s with no issues.
Ive seen other 4wds run 33"s with no issues with the lift ur going for but honestly i dont know if they had the rim size/off set ur going for.

Id say they will fit with no problems, but maybe someone running that specific rim can answer u.
 
im running the same setup. i had to crank the torsion bars an inch to avoid rubbing while turning. I heard it rub as soon as i backed out of the driveway, so I got right out of the truck and cranked them up.
